
WWE acquiring Mexican lucha libre promotion AAA will see a lot of changes in the coming weeks and they will be holding their first joint event called WWE x AAA Worlds Collide next month. Theres speculation about Alberto Del Rio appearing at the event and now his status has been revealed.
While speaking on WrestleVotes Radio, WrestleVotes reported that several AAA wrestlers are currently planned to appear at the upcoming Worlds Collide event. The names include Aero Star, Chik Tormenta, El Hijo de Dr. Wagner Jr., El Hijo del Vikingo, Laredo Kid, Mr. Iguana, Octagon Jr., Pagano, and Psycho Clown.
However, one notable name thats missing is Alberto Del Rio, so it is highly unexpected that he will be part of the upcoming event on June 7th. This comes after it was previously reported that Alberto Del Rio remains signed to AAA and WWE will just be inheriting that contract eventually.
AAA recently announced a match between Alberto Del Rio and El Hijo del Vikingo for an upcoming event scheduled on May 31st, before WWE x AAA Worlds Collide, showing that AAA still sees Del Rio as a major star. However, this doesnt mean WWE has any plans to use him once they officially take over.
Because of Alberto Del Rios past problems with WWE and the bad media attention hes gotten in recent years, WWE is likely choosing to stay away from him, even if hes working with AAA. No matter what, he wont be at the Worlds Collide event, and thats not expected to change.
